Summary
CVE-2023-41910 is a critical-severity Out-of-bounds Read (CWE-125) vulnerability in Lldpd Project Lldpd. Its CVSS base score is 9.8 (Critical).
Operationally, ranked at the 36.0th percentile by exploit likelihood (below the median); it is not currently listed in the CISA KEV catalog.

Vulnerability details
An issue was discovered in lldpd before 1.0.17. By crafting a CDP PDU packet with specific CDP_TLV_ADDRESSES TLVs, a malicious actor can remotely force the lldpd daemon to perform an out-of-bounds read on heap memory. This occurs in cdp_decode in…
